Säiliöinnin ymmärtäminen: edut, käyttötapaukset ja parhaat käytännöt
Säiliöinti on prosessi, jossa sovellus ja sen riippuvuudet pakataan kevyeen, kannettavaan säiliöön, jota voidaan käyttää johdonmukaisesti eri ympäristöissä. Tämän ansiosta kehittäjät voivat helposti ottaa käyttöön ja hallita sovelluksiaan useissa eri asetuksissa, kuten paikallisissa palvelimissa, pilvialustoissa tai jopa paikallisissa kehityskoneissa.
Säilöt ovat samanlaisia kuin virtuaalikoneita (VM:t), mutta niissä on joitain keskeisiä eroja:
1 . Kevyt: Säiliöt ovat paljon pienempiä ja kevyempiä kuin virtuaalikoneet, mikä tekee niistä nopeamman käynnistyksen ja tehokkaampia resurssien käytön suhteen.
2. Kannettava: Säiliöt on suunniteltu siirrettäviksi eri ympäristöissä, joten voit helposti siirtää sovelluksesi ympäristöstä toiseen ilman, että sinun tarvitsee huolehtia yhteensopivuusongelmista.
3. Eristys: Säilöt tarjoavat korkean tason eristyksen samassa isännässä toimivien sovellusten välillä, mikä auttaa estämään ristiriitoja ja parantamaan turvallisuutta.
4. Joustavuus: Säiliöitä voidaan helposti pyörittää ylös tai alas tarpeen mukaan, jolloin voit skaalata sovelluksesi nopeasti muuttuviin tarpeisiin.
5. Hallinnan helppous: Säiliöitä on helppo hallita ja ylläpitää, koska ne eivät vaadi samantasoista asiantuntemusta kuin virtuaalikoneista.
Joitakin yleisiä konttien käyttötapauksia ovat:
1. Verkkosovellukset: Säiliöi verkkosovellukset, jotta ne on helpompi ottaa käyttöön ja hallita eri ympäristöissä.
2. Mikropalvelut: Käytä säiliöitä mikropalvelujen pakkaamiseen ja käyttöönottoon. Ne ovat pieniä, itsenäisiä palveluita, joita voidaan helposti skaalata ja hallita.
3. Vanhojen sovellusten modernisointi: Säiliöi vanhoja sovelluksia, jotta ne olisivat kannettavampia ja helpompia ylläpitää.
4. Pilvipohjaiset sovellukset: Luo pilvipohjaisia sovelluksia käyttämällä konttia hyödyntääksesi pilvipalvelun skaalautuvuutta ja joustavuutta.
5. DevOps: Käytä säilöjä osana DevOps-putkilinjaa sovellusten rakennus-, testaus- ja käyttöönottoprosessin automatisoimiseen.



